Sorry for the late response on this matter. In article <jwv7i0rml4c.fsf-monnier+emacsbugreports <at> gnu.org>, Stefan Monnier <monnier <at> IRO.UMontreal.CA> writes: > > I can't reproduce this. Could you provide a self-contained testcase? > Sure: > xrdb -remove > rm ~/.Xdefaults > src/emacs -Q --eval '(set-face-font (quote default) \ > "-misc-fixed-medium-r-semicondensed--13-*-*-*-*-*-*-*")' > C-u C-\ TeX RET > a > \ ' e > \ ' r > \ f o r a l l > "aéŕ" use misc-fixed-semicondensed (the first two with iso8859-1 and > the last with iso8859-2), but "∀" is displayed with > xft:-unknown-DejaVu Sans-normal-normal-semi-condensed-*-13-*-*-*-*-0-iso10646-1 ∀ belongs to `symbol' script, but the xfont backend didn't support :script font property. That is because I was afraid that it made the font listing extremely slow (we must open all iso10646-1 fonts to check if it supports the requested characters). Actually my trial implementation of :script property supports took more than 1 minute to display HELLO file. But, if we can use this heuristic: X fonts that have the same property values except for size related properties supports the same set of characters on all display. For example, all these fonts -adobe-courier-medium-r-normal--8-80-75-75-m-50-iso10646-1 -adobe-courier-medium-r-normal--10-100-75-75-m-60-iso10646-1 -adobe-courier-medium-r-normal--11-80-100-100-m-60-iso10646-1 -adobe-courier-medium-r-normal--12-120-75-75-m-70-iso10646-1 -adobe-courier-medium-r-normal--14-100-100-100-m-90-iso10646-1 -adobe-courier-medium-r-normal--14-140-75-75-m-90-iso10646-1 -adobe-courier-medium-r-normal--17-120-100-100-m-100-iso10646-1 -adobe-courier-medium-r-normal--18-180-75-75-m-110-iso10646-1 -adobe-courier-medium-r-normal--20-140-100-100-m-110-iso10646-1 -adobe-courier-medium-r-normal--24-240-75-75-m-150-iso10646-1 -adobe-courier-medium-r-normal--25-180-100-100-m-150-iso10646-1 -adobe-courier-medium-r-normal--34-240-100-100-m-200-iso10646-1 suports the same set of characters. we can list fonts in a realistic time. Attached is the patch to try it. Could you please test it?
